Why You're Getting "No Relevant Snippets Found"

Now that we've covered what this message looks like, let's explore why you're getting it in the first place. Here are some possible explanations:

  • Your search query was too vague or generic
  • The information you're looking for is not widely available online
  • You might be searching for something that's been removed from the internet or is no longer relevant
  • It's possible that your search engine settings need to be tweaked

Alternative Ways to Find What You're Looking For

If the usual suspects don't work, it might be time to think outside the box. Here are a few alternative ways to find what you're searching for:

  • Try broadening your search query or using related keywords
  • Check out online forums or discussion boards
  • Visit websites that specialize in the topic you're interested in
  • Consider reaching out to experts or industry professionals

The key here is to be patient and persistent. Sometimes, it takes a little extra effort to find what we're looking for.
